I didn't get this specific in my earlier post, but one of the times that I do like to use Stopping Shot is when I see that my target's Action pool is getting low for whatever reason (e.g., if there are other group members who are attacking Action). If I see thatthe target'sMind is dropping for any reason (e.g., if there's a Rifleman in the group, as you said), I switch to Eye Shot--although Stopping Shot (or else Fan Shot) would probably be the next-best choice for a non-Desperado Pistoleer in the latter situation.
I also greatly prefer Fan Shotinstead ofHealth Shot when attacking a mob, because as LordMaxx alluded, it causes far more total damage per unit time than cycling through targets with Health Shot 2. I must qualify that statement though... If I am using Fan Shot on a tough mob with high individual HAMs (things that take more than a few shots to kill), I am not sure that spamming exclusively Fan Shot is necessarily the fastest way to take them down. What I do in that case is hit each one with bleeds first, and then start spamming Fan Shot. If the targets are sufficiently weak that they will be dead before the bleeds weaken them much, then I don't bother with the bleeds and go straight for Fan Shot.
